Does Gum Cause Acne. While not every case of acne is caused by poor dental health, it is something to keep in mind. Acne around the mouth is commonly caused by hormones and genetics. These habits can trap oil, sweat, and bacteria around your mouth and contribute to acne. When you don’t brush or floss. Poor oral hygiene and acne. Lifestyle factors can also contribute, such as frequently talking on the phone, wearing a mask, or touching your face often. Studies have shown that the bad bacteria from an abscessed (infected) tooth or gum disease can get onto your face and cause skin irritation and breakouts. Poor oral hygiene can also lead to inflammation, which can trigger or worsen acne.
